Mar 12, 2019 · In addition to caffeine, yerba mate contains two other stimulants: theobromine and theophylline. The combination of caffeine, theobromine, and theophylline provides a long-lasting and pleasant stimulating effect with enhanced mental focus. Yerba mate also has several healthy components such as polyphenols and saponins.

mate, tealike beverage, popular in many South American countries, brewed from the dried leaves of an evergreen shrub or tree ( Ilex paraguariensis) related to holly. It is a stimulating drink, greenish in colour, containing caffeine and tannin, and is less astringent than tea. Connect with the energizing … Worsened sleep quality – Caffeine in yerba maté can make it harder to fall asleep and shorten the time you spend in deep sleep. This effect can occur even if you drink caffeinated yerba earlier in the day, as the half-life is about 5 hours and can be as long as 9.5 hours in people who metabolize caffeine slowly.
